Sutton Common is a minimalist station, providing only essential services. You'll find no ticket office here, but rest assured that ticket machines are available for both purchases and collections. These machines are accessible and acc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Additionally, smartcard validators are installed at the station. However, if you're planning an extended wait, be prepared as there are no refreshment facilities, ATMs, or waiting rooms. Seating areas do exist, so you can sit back and enjoy a good book while waiting for your train.
When it comes to assistance, the station is unstaffed, but help can be arranged via the available Help Point or by contacting Thameslink's dedicated helpline. There’s no step-free access at this Category C station, so plan accordingly if you’re traveling with luggage or have mobility requirements.

Esher Station is equipped with a variety of facilities to make your journey comfortable and hassle-free. The ticket office operates during regular hours, offering assistance from Monday through Sunday. For those on the go, 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ting pre-booked tickets, ensuring you can travel at your convenience. With Smartcard validators located on site, traveling couldn't be easier. It's worth noting, however, that while there are accessible ticket machines, step-free access is only partially available, and those needing assistance should plan accordingly.
Refreshments are available for that essential caffeine fix, with a cozy coffee kiosk located within the booking hall. While the station lacks an ATM or retail shops, it compensates with other conveniences like public Wi-Fi and bicycle storage facilities. You can even find sheltered and CCTV-monitored bicycle stands, ideal for cyclists planning to continue their journey on two wheels.
